We have a problem setting up multiple BGP sessions with the same (upstream) IP address. What we try to achieve here is to have two or more BGP sessions with the same IP address, but with different public AS numbers. For example:
Upstream peer is AS6238x
Peer IP is 185.23x.64.1
Downstream peers are: AS3951x and AS4887x.
When we try to add a second downstream peer to the same IP address of the upstream Peer, we get an error message:
Couldn't change BGP Peer <name_here_2> - already exists (6)
Similary, when we try to establish on the upstream Peer router a downstream session with the two ASNs we get the following error:
Couldn't change BGP Peer <name_here_2> - already exists (6)
Both routers are CCR1036 (for the Upstream and the Downstream as well).
What should we do ?
